Oh I can't wait to be beside the sea again! For this project 'Smell of the Sea' I used Winnie - Building Sandcastles and Relaxing Sunlounger from Polkadoodles. Both coloured using ProMarkers. The backing paper is from 6x6  Peeling Paint paper pack. I attached a few Tropical Palm Trees with some tiny polystyrene embellishment balls. Sentiment is from Winnie Mermazing Mermaid Quotes. The sky and sand are water coloured using Mozart Komorebi Watercolors.

For my 'Back to School' project, I made this vintage school bag using papers from the  Winston Deluxe Download Collection . The flowers and zip are from the same collection. The pencils are from  Winnie Fruit Punch Embellies  which I recoloured.   I used a box die to make my school bag shape. I inked up the edges in brown distress oxide. I made a pocket from a rectangle die and attached the zip to the top, for the pencils - adding some stitching with a white gel pen.  Meet Me Under the Mistletoe Christmas in July arrived at Create and Craft TV and Polkadoodles were showcasing the fabulous  Gnome-azing Christmas Collection     There's a lot going on with this sample card for the show.  I used Gnome Meet Me Under the  Mistletoe  and coloured using Copics and ProMarkers. I stenciled the background using Trees/Foliage Great Outdoors Stencil then glittered using Glamour Dust. I stenciled the trees again with Distress Oxide, then cut out and attached to give a woodland theme. The door is from Woodland Door Die . The little trees and Noel are from Itsy Bits Plywood Decorative Shapes.
